The Heard Quitter

The Heard Quitter is a remarkable oil on canvas painting created by Charles Marion Russell in 1897. This western scene features cowboys on horseback herding cattle, showcasing the artist's exceptional skill in capturing the spirit of the American West. The painting is currently housed at the Montana Museum of Art and Culture in the United States.

Artistic Style and Technique

Charles Marion Russell's artistic style is characterized by his ability to convey a sense of adventure and excitement in his paintings. In The Heard Quitter, he employs a range of techniques, including the use of bold brushstrokes and vivid colors, to create a dynamic and engaging scene. The painting's composition, with its emphasis on movement and energy, draws the viewer's eye into the heart of the action. Key Elements of the Painting Some of the key elements that make The Heard Quitter such a compelling work include:
  • The dramatic pose of the cowboys on horseback, which conveys a sense of tension and urgency
  • The use of light and shadow to create depth and atmosphere in the painting
  • The inclusion of a dog, which adds a sense of realism and authenticity to the scene

Charles Marion Russell's Legacy

Charles Marion Russell is widely regarded as one of the most important American artists of the early 20th century. His paintings, such as A Serious Predicament and Whiskey Smugglers Caught with the Goods, are highly prized for their historical significance and artistic merit.
